Treatment for ADHD
There are a variety of options for ADHD treatment. Based on the signs your child experiences, they may need treatment, medication or other behavioral treatments. Your healthcare provider is the best way to find the best ADHD treatment for your child. They might recommend a medication or therapy that works for you and your child.
Medication is often the first treatment option for ADHD. stimulants can help alleviate some symptoms. However, stimulants may also cause anxiety. Your doctor and you will have to keep track of your child's reaction to medications and make adjustments.
Cognitive behavioral therapy is another treatment option for ADHD. This kind of therapy focuses on changing negative thinking and emotional states. It can be performed either in a private or group setting.
A structured and structured environment is another beneficial treatment for ADHD. The presence of clear rules and a schedule can assist your child to get more done and focus on the most important things. A support group can be set up for children suffering from ADHD who have trouble focusing.
One of the most effective ways to support your child is to provide them with positive feedback when they are doing something well. You can also encourage them to engage with their peers.

ADHD medications ADHD
ADHD medications are a great option to help people suffering from ADHD focus and improve their relationships with other people. They may also help reduce symptoms of impulsivity, hyperactivity and social withdrawal.
Your healthcare provider can assist you choose the appropriate medication for ADHD. Your response to the medication will be monitored by the doctor. If you experience any side symptoms, your physician will alter the dosage.
Your health care team will require you to attend appointments regularly. This will include visiting your doctor every three to six months. Sometimes, your doctor could prescribe more than one medication.
There are a few side effects you may experience when you first begin taking ADHD medication. These can include anxiety, headaches, stomach upset and nervousness. But, they usually disappear after a couple of days.
Treatments for ADHD come in two types including stimulants and other non-stimulants. They work by increasing the levels of neurotransmitters in the brain. Neurotransmitters are vital for motivation and thinking.
Many doctors recommend starting with a small dose of stimulant. This is referred to as a "titrating dose". Your response to treatment will be used by your health care professional to adjust the dose.
ADHD medications that act long-lastingly can be taken once daily. Certain medications are extended-release. They are easier to remember since they last longer.
Your doctor may prescribe a combination or nonstimulant drug depending on your particular needs. It is possible to try the drug atomoxetine which is an anti-stimulant drug, if you have trouble with stimulants.
Finding the right treatment for your ADHD is often a trial-and-error process. It is important to be aware of any side consequences, like changing your diet.
